Company Overview

Walgreens Boots Alliance operates a network of over 13,000 retail pharmacies in the United States, Europe, and Latin America. The company also has a wholesale pharmaceutical distribution business and a pharmaceutical manufacturing business. WBA's mission is to help people live healthier and happier lives by providing convenient access to affordable healthcare products and services.
